MotoGP United States GP Movitar Yamaha Day 1 – Valentino Rossi achieved the fourth fastest time on the first day of free practice for the Grand Prix of the Americas, third stage of the 2018 MotoGP World Championship.

The Yamaha rider from Pesaro showed a fast and solid pace since FP1 and confirmed the good sensations in the afternoon too. The #46 worked together with the team to set up the tires and electronics, saying he was satisfied. He has the microphone.

“The first session was quite positive because I was fast from the start, even though the track wasn't in good condition. Now we have to work on the balance of the bike, on the tyres, to understand what the best options are for the race. We also need to work on the electronics, to improve acceleration out of corners.”

“The second session was also positive, I classified fourth and was quite fast. We worked on the race pace because with the medium tires there is a little less grip, so we still have some work to do, but the feeling is positive – said Valentino Rossi – The track is a little better than this morning . We'll see what the weather will be like tomorrow, even if the forecast says it will rain. We are working hard, in Argentina we took the wrong path, here we have changed direction and it seems to be going better. Marquez didn't do a real time attack, then both Vinales and I are going strong, as are Crutchlow and Iannone."
